Dr. Rarey opened the meeting with an overview of the 2003-04 Fall courses, Spring courses, Clerkships (numeric & narrative). Data was reviewed and discussed with consistent and/or improved scoring overall. Two tardy spring courses were also reviewed, (Human Behavior, and Principles in Physiology). Dr. Rarey asked the committee to review the narrative comments on the courses, clerkships. He recommended that as a member it would be relevant to review the comments based on the scoring you gave an individual course/clerkship.

At this time the committee sighted that there is a lack of participation with a clerkship. Dr. Romrell was asked what the position the CC takes with this issue. He declared that if a course or clerkship director does not meet the criteria that is expected/required, they would be reviewed and possibly be effected by the overall budget allocation for their course/clerkship.

Dr. Ritz-asked Dr. Rarey about the duration of a clerkship. "Does the Evaluation Subcommittee have any input?" Dr. Rarey responded by mentioning the CC reviews the course/clerkship duration, guidelines etc. He suggested any concerns should be addressed to the CC.

Dr. Rarey commented about competencies. Rarey asked Lou Ritz to review and report to Dr. Romrell. Cynthia K. mentioned that she is continuing to update/revise a flow chart of competencies that would be able to be viewed at the website.
